If you’re even slightly acquainted with Skip Bayless, you’re aware of his unwavering dedication to the Dallas Cowboys. However, after the team’s disappointing 7-10 season and missing the playoffs for the first time since 2020, his devotion is quickly morphing into disdain. Not only did Bayless have to witness his beloved Cowboys struggle, but he also had to endure the Philadelphia Eagles capturing a Super Bowl title.
Throughout the years, the former FS1 host has experienced numerous public meltdowns over the Cowboys. In his latest dramatic four-minute rant shared on X, he took his frustration to an extreme by swapping his Cowboys jersey for an Eagles one, hoping to alter the luck of both teams. “It has come to this for me,” he remarked as he grabbed the new jersey. “I have now purchased, with my own money, this jersey featuring a quarterback I have always loved, Jalen Hurts, and a team I have always hated, the freaking Philadelphia Eagles. I hate this color; it makes me sick to my stomach. It has come to this ladies and gentlemen. Behold Cowboys Nation… What do you think? Fly Eagles fly! It is your fault, Jerry Jones! You made me do this!”

To be fair, Bayless has long supported Jalen Hurts, who had a standout season at the University of Oklahoma before making his mark in the NFL. Nevertheless, publicly singing the Eagles’ fight song seems to represent a new low in Bayless’s Cowboys fandom. Only time will reveal if his new ‘good luck charm’ will shift the fortunes of both the Cowboys and the Eagles in 2025. One thing is clear: Bayless is desperately hoping for a Cowboys Super Bowl appearance for the first time in 30 years.
